Transaction 7568f4173d84356745a551ba68829700c74e0353080c126e28d08dbbbc19a271

1 Input
2 Outputs
  • 7568f4173d84356745a551ba68829700c74e0353080c126e28d08dbbbc19a271:0
  • value  2581049
    address  1NGQDyBVCj73vyqhog1bwuHmiH1mcHKqoj
  • 7568f4173d84356745a551ba68829700c74e0353080c126e28d08dbbbc19a271:1
  • value  83753
    address  1DqHcrZganJiSBZtXqbVi3E9RvCpnVNav6